**Ticket: SNAP-2291 — Stale snapshots in Lanternfish UI kit**

Several snapshot tests for the `PriceBadge` and `StepperInput` components are failing after the Quillmark theme refresh. The stored snapshots still reflect the old border radii, so diffs are noisy and hard to review. Please regenerate snapshots only for the affected components, not the whole suite — a full regen last month hid a real regression in `ModalFrame`. Marisol on the design side has approved the new renders. The failing pipeline run carries the build token below.

session token of bawep-yadup = htk21_528abd376e3c5a4ec24a1

## Configuration

Nightfill runs backfills from a single env file in the repo root. Set the warehouse host, the schedule window, and the retry cap there. Defaults are fine for dev. Do not commit the file; it is gitignored on purpose. Ask your lead for the staging values. The warehouse access credential goes on the line directly after this section.

sealed setting: VAULT_KEY8=a77b1885

## Inventory Write-Down — Restricted: Managers

Kettleford Supply will record a write-down on aged stock at the Marwick and Dunlowe branches this quarter. Affected lines are the Frostline coolers and legacy Permacrate units. Branch managers should reconcile counts by month-end and route questions to Regional Ops. The underlying plan driving this decision is noted below.

management briefing: The renewal with Quenathox Group closes at $10 million a year, 20 percent below the last contract. Project Ulawyn slips by two quarters because of the supplier delay.